    Plan the meal around the confirmed opening days

    Stockerwirt is listed as closed on Monday and Tuesday. It opens from 11:30 AM to 12 AM on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, Saturday, from 11:30 AM to 7 PM on Sunday. Those hours support earlier arrival times on open days, while Sunday requires an earlier finish.

    What should I wear to Stockerwirt?

    The verified dress code is smart casual. You do not need formalwear, but aim for a neat, polished look that fits a recognized restaurant in Sulz im Wienerwald.

    Location

    Rohrberg 36, 2392 Sulz im Wienerwald, Austria
